Tetsumasa Kamei is a scholar working on Neurology,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ience. According to data from OpenAlex, Tetsumasa Kamei has authored 24 papers receiving a total of 199 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 17 papers in Neurology, 7 papers in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and 5 papers in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ience. Recurrent topics in Tetsumasa Kamei’s work include Neurological disorders and treatments (9 papers), Advanced MRI Techniques and Applications (6 papers) and Parkinson's Disease Mechanisms and Treatments (5 papers). Tetsumasa Kamei is often cited by papers focused on Neurological disorders and treatments (9 papers), Advanced MRI Techniques and Applications (6 papers) and Parkinson's Disease Mechanisms and Treatments (5 papers). Tetsumasa Kamei collaborates with scholars based in Japan, United States and Canada. Tetsumasa Kamei's co-authors include Hisashi Ito, Kazuaki Yamamoto, Takaomi Taira, Toshio Yamaguchi, Aritoshi Iida, Shiro Ikegawa, Shuichi Oshima, Motoki Sano, Yusuke Nakamura and Michiaki Kubo and has published in prestigious journals such as Neurobiology of Aging, Journal of Computer Assisted Tomography and Patient Preference and Adherence.
